On , OSHA opened a complaint safety inspection of SAVERS, TVI in 222A E ST., MARLBOROUGH, MA 01752 (NAICS 453310). OSHA activity number 343763462.

What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ons: rout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

2 citations on file for this inspection.

1910.178 L04 III

Serious Gravity 10 2 instances 3 exposed
Issued
Mar 5, 2019
Abate by
Apr 5, 2019
Penalty
Initial $12,934 · Current $9,054 Reduced
29 CFR 1910.178(l)(4)(iii): An evaluation of each powered industrial truck operator's performance shall be conducted at least once every three years.   Location: Donation warehouse floor. On or about February 6, 2019, an evaluation of each powered industrial truck operator's performance was not conducted at least once every three years.

1910.1200 F06 I

Other-than-serious 1 instance 1 exposed
Issued
Mar 5, 2019
Abate by
Apr 5, 2019
Penalty
Initial $1,063 · Current $744 Reduced
29 CFR 1910.1200(f)(6)(i): Except as provided in 29 CFR 1910.1200(f)(7) and 29 CFR 1910.1200(f)(8), the employer did not ensure that each container of hazardous chemicals in the workplace was labeled, tagged or marked with the information required by 29 CFR 1910.1200(f)(1)(i) through 29 CFR 1910.1200(f)(1)(v).   On or about February 6, 2019, a portable spray container containing disinfectant Steri-Fab was not labeled, tagged, or marked with information denoting the chemical composition and/or related chemical hazards.
